Paula Gearon

Paula Gearon is a highly experienced software engineer currently working in the advanced threats division at Cisco Systems.2 She has a diverse background in software engineering, technical architecture, and open-source advisory services. Paula holds a Bachelor of Science in Physics from CQUniversity and a Bachelor of Engineering in Computer Systems from The University of Queensland.

Throughout her career, Paula has held various roles, including:

  • Software Engineer at Cisco (current position)2
  • Principal Engineer at Revelytix, Inc
  • Open Source Advisor specializing in Semantic Web Technology at E-Me Ventures
  • Technical Lead in Semantic Technology Projects at Duraspace
  • Technical Architect at Fourthcodex and Herzum
  • Semantic Consultant at Gearon Software Services

Paula has extensive experience in graph databases and semantic web technologies. She worked on developing a triplestore database and was involved in creating the SPARQL query language for RDF databases.2 Her expertise also extends to rule systems and description logic, which she has applied in her work on the open-source Naga project at Cisco.1

Paula is known for her contributions to the Clojure community and has given talks at conferences such as Clojure/conj.1 She can be found on Twitter as @quoll and on GitHub with the username quoll.1
